Portrait of Isaac Newton (1642-1727) Product:Greetings card 23rd February 1972Head and shoulder portrait of Newton wearing a dark coat and waistcoat, with a white neck cloth. Inscribed below the image 'SIR ISAAC NEWTON DRAWN AND SCRAPED MDCCLX BY JAMES MACARDEL FROM AN ORIGINAL PORTRAIT PAINTED BY ENOCH SEEMAN NOW IN THE POSSESSION OF THOMAS HOLLIS F. R. AND A. S. S.'
